About Our Society

Do you revel in the weird? Do you enjoy dissecting difficult problems? We’re the society for you!

Whether you’re a turtleneck-wearing philosopher or you just enjoy thinking deeply, we invite you to join us!

Founded in 1965, the Philosophy Society serves to encourage learning, thinking, and discussion of philosophical ideas. We’ve invited interesting guest speakers like Noam Chomsky and Norman Finkelstein, and we regularly host events that invite discussion and philosophical inquiry about countless topics.
